SUBJECT / RECOMMENDATIONS | |
Approve Memorandum of Agreement for Tampa Bay Academy of Hope for the Provision of Services for the Full Service School Program (Student Services and Federal Programs Division) | |
EXECUTIVE SUMMARY | |
The Full Service School Program at Just and Sanchez Full Service School Centers has developed and implemented a strategic planning process to improve services for families and students in east and west Tampa communities. Community residents, agency staff members, and educators have been involved in this process. The goal has been to develop effective working relationships with select community partners who will support family self-sufficiency and student performance. Decisions have been made, based upon several identified school and community needs, to partner with select agency partners at the Just and Sanchez Full Service School Centers to support this goal. This agreement has been prepared to describe the working relationship between the Full School Program, the Full Service School Centers, families, educators, and the Tampa Bay Academy of Hope. | |

FINANCIAL IMPACT (Budgeted: No) | |
These services will be provided at no cost to the district or the families in these communities. The provider has agreed to work in cooperation with the Full Service School Centers’ staff and in partnership with other educators and community agency representatives. The district will provide office space and phone service at the Full Service School Centers, when feasible. | |
EVALUATION | |
The Supervisor of School Social Work Services and the Coordinator of the Full Service School Program will evaluate the effectiveness of program services. The forementioned staff will meet regularly and review this agreement. Program evaluation will include the number and scope of program service activities; amount of time the program is on campus to meet client needs; support for the partnership with the Full Service School Centers' mission and goals; and feedback about the effectiveness of services from clients, area principals, and school social workers. | |
